Ordinals
beta
Sat 711360196067154
decimal
142272.196067154
degree
0°142272′1152″196067154‴
percentile
33.8742950880786%
name
iusrmebylpf
cycle
0
epoch
0
period
70
block
142272
offset
196067154
timestamp
2011-08-23 15:19:58 UTC
rarity
common
prev
next